What Is the Migration Agents Registration Authority (MARA) in Australia?
The Migration Agents Registration Authority (MARA) is the official body in Australia that regulates migration agents. Its role is to make sure that anyone providing immigration advice or visa services is qualified, registered, and follows strict professional standards. In simple terms, MARA protects applicants by ensuring that only trained and accountable professionals can guide them through the visa process.
A MARA-registered agent is legally recognized and must meet ongoing requirements such as professional training, ethical conduct, and compliance with Australian law. This means that when you choose an Australia MARA agent, you are working with someone who is monitored by the government and held responsible for the advice they give. What Are the Key Advantages of Choosing a MARA-Registered Consultant for PR Applications?
Applying for Permanent Residency (PR) in Australia is one of the most important steps for individuals and families who want to build a future in the country. For Indian citizens, the process can feel complicated because it involves understanding eligibility criteria, preparing documents, and meeting the points-based system requirements. A MARA-registered Australia PR consultant makes this journey easier by offering step-by-step guidance.
The process usually begins with an eligibility assessment, where the consultant checks your skills, qualifications, and work experience against Australia’s skilled occupation lists. From there, they guide you through English language requirements, skill assessments, and Expression of Interest (EOI) submissions. Finally, they help lodge the visa application with complete documentation. This structured approach reduces errors and increases the chances of approval.
